These properties are used to specify whether data is oriented vertically or horizontally.\n"],null,["# Enum Dimension\n\nDimension\n\nAn enumeration of possible directions along which data can be stored in a spreadsheet.\n\nTo call an enum, you call its parent class, name, and property. For example, `\nSpreadsheetApp.Dimension.COLUMNS`. \n\n### Properties\n\n| Property | Type | Description |\n|-----------|--------|----------------------------------|\n| `COLUMNS` | `Enum` | The column (vertical) dimension. |\n| `ROWS` | `Enum` | The row (horizontal) dimension. |"]]
